Jun 28, 2022 16:51 CESTJune 22 (Renewables Now) - Vietnamese photovoltaics (PV) manufacturer Boviet Solar announced today an order to supply 138 MW of PV modules to an unnamed developer of a project in the US.
The company will deliver Vega Series PERC monocrystalline - bifacial double-glass PV panels of 550 W each. It did not disclose further details about the order.
"The modules selected by this developer offer an impressive 550 watts of capacity and cutting-edge bifacial design, allowing them to maximize power production for the project. This, in turn, optimizes the entire project's levelized cost of energy and its profitability," commented Sienna Cen, President of Boviet Solar USA.
